Selecting a Topic

 The most important part of the Science Fair!
 Pick a topic that INTERESTS you.
 Pick a topic that is NEW not something you have
seen a lot of.
 Pick something that is TESTABLE.
 Make sure it is REALISTIC (you will have until Oct.
21st to complete your experiment.
 Make sure YOU HAVE THE RESOURCES.
Restrictions

 Mentos and Soda
 Popcorn popping
 Food that molds
 Models (creating a model of the solar system,
volcano, water cycle, etc.)
 Can not harm animals or people – including
ingesting of chemicals, physical, or mental harm.
 Fire

Question

 Once you have decided on a topic then you need to
create a general question to answer.
 There can not be any pronouns in your question.
 The question needs to be testable
 This needs to include your independent variable
 For example my topic is Speed
 My question could be: Does height affect the speed
of a ball?
